commit
64ba0fb32e
@ -32,6 +32,7 @@
|
|||||||
register: dhcpd_register_nameservers
|
register: dhcpd_register_nameservers
|
||||||
changed_when: False
|
changed_when: False
|
||||||
when: dhcpd_mode == 'server'
|
when: dhcpd_mode == 'server'
|
||||||
|
always_run: yes
|
||||||
|
|
||||||
- name: Convert list of nameservers to Ansible list
|
- name: Convert list of nameservers to Ansible list
|
||||||
set_fact:
|
set_fact:
|
||||||
|
@ -6,10 +6,10 @@ option domain-search "{{ dhcpd_tpl_domain_search | join('", "') }}";
|
|||||||
option dhcp6.domain-search "{{ dhcpd_tpl_domain_search | join('", "') }}";
|
option dhcp6.domain-search "{{ dhcpd_tpl_domain_search | join('", "') }}";
|
||||||
|
|
||||||
{% endif %}
|
{% endif %}
|
||||||
|
{% set dhcpd_tpl_nameservers = [] %}
|
||||||
{% if dhcpd_nameservers|d() and dhcpd_nameservers %}
|
{% if dhcpd_nameservers|d() and dhcpd_nameservers %}
|
||||||
{% set dhcpd_tpl_nameservers = dhcpd_nameservers %}
|
{% set dhcpd_tpl_nameservers = dhcpd_nameservers %}
|
||||||
{% elif dhcpd_runtime_nameservers|d() and dhcpd_runtime_nameservers %}
|
{% elif dhcpd_runtime_nameservers|d() and dhcpd_runtime_nameservers %}
|
||||||
{% set dhcpd_tpl_nameservers = [] %}
|
|
||||||
{% for server in dhcpd_runtime_nameservers %}
|
{% for server in dhcpd_runtime_nameservers %}
|
||||||
{% if server not in [ '127.0.0.1', '::1' ] %}
|
{% if server not in [ '127.0.0.1', '::1' ] %}
|
||||||
{% set _ = dhcpd_tpl_nameservers.append(server) %}
|
{% set _ = dhcpd_tpl_nameservers.append(server) %}
|
||||||
|
Loading…
Reference in New Issue
Block a user